Transaction 51b2bf9339d40bf6e0be4b10db3dd77d79ce904a06f31be7549b03faff2ae91a

1 Input
2 Outputs
  • 51b2bf9339d40bf6e0be4b10db3dd77d79ce904a06f31be7549b03faff2ae91a:0
  • value  123142
    address  3KSU456iLUFvPbWaPasVNV1sFrhSBCtpjr
  • 51b2bf9339d40bf6e0be4b10db3dd77d79ce904a06f31be7549b03faff2ae91a:1
  • value  9893809
    address  3CLq6x6hsE9EyXWYoFntFD4VFndEiFJBji